Trying to work on Saturday morning, always brings you reading some news around..:P And this is how I found myself on the trace of the photographer of Between war and Peace , James Hill. Originally English, he is now living in Russia, but travelling around as NY Times photographer. His photodiary in Afghanistan war is really touching, and it brings you in discovering, as rarely happens, these womanish and mannish suffering eyes behind the net of fear.


His spots seems to be stolen in the perfect moment, in the perfect instant in which silence takes the place of the war uproar. Just a moment, a moment of humanity, of living. And in the portrait he steals even more, he steals the angry look of a young lady without Chador, he sees the detail in a crowd.
